CABLE RULING MAY RETURN REGULATION POWER TO THE CITY

This article comes from our electronic archive and has not been reviewed. It may contain glitches.
Friday, June 14, 1991

Reaction was mixed Thursday to a Federal Communications Commission decision to allow local governments to regulate the prices charged by about 60 percent of the nation's cable systems.
